Question : 20

The door of Aditya's house faces the East. From the back side of his house, he walks straight 50 meters, then turns to the right and walks 50 meters again. Finally, he turns towards left and stops after walking 25 meters. Now, Aditya is in which direction from the starting point?

a) North - East

b) South - East

c) South - West

d) North - West

Answer: (d)

Since Aditya's house faces towards East and he walks from backside of his house, it means that he starts walking towards West.

Thus, the movements of Aditya are as shown in Fig. 37 (A to B, B to C, C to D).

Clearly, Aditya's final position is D which is to the North - West of the starting point A.
